yes you can use it, it'll run 2 days on a 7-9ah battery on the ice so long as the battery is decently charged
Just use the 2d open water transducer and loop the cord - no need to buy an ice ducer. Plus the open water allows you to use the narrow 455khz beam which is outstanding for ice fishing - it never gets interference
